Output 2cf58882eae133d96fa8ebdf5dc3aa4770d4636a4be0bd38d7f35d1263360caa:1

value
630231
script pubkey
OP_0 OP_PUSHBYTES_20 c5d62c9ed5508c4c2dce7170354aa6a3d506e3ef
address
tb1qchtze8k42zxyctwww9cr2j4x502sdcl05tkg2j
transaction
2cf58882eae133d96fa8ebdf5dc3aa4770d4636a4be0bd38d7f35d1263360caa
confirmations
115118
spent
false